It's different from most new MMORPGs out there.

There are no classes or races, just skills and abilities which you purchase and enhance via points awarded for reaching various milestones of XP (no actual levels).
Game is not exactly about completing all the missions in a given place as there are countless of them.

It takes place in a modern world, just with the Occult&Supernatural thrown in, such as Zombies, Demons, Magic, Lovecraftian Horrors, etc...

I played a little, and it is pretty interesting. It truly breaks from old formulas by allowing you to pick your skills by simply changing your equipped weapon. Something about it feels like City of Heroes to me, although that isn't a great comparison. The quests are also fairly interesting, you have a lot of cut-scenes (not as much as SWTOR) and objectives that having you following paranormal activity around or doing surveillance against a target. There are even stealth missions and the like.

The only thing I would say is that the game appears to be fairly hardcore in the MMORPG department. The skills use MMORPG lingo like DOT, PBAOE, and LOADS of modifiers. The premise behind skills is that you tend to stack status effects on targets then unleash a skill that creates a different effect off that first status effect (i.e. you inflict "weakness" on a target and then fire your skill that does X damage and, if target is weakened, weakens targets in X radius). Lots of chaining like that.

LOL! Well, it's really a conspiracy theorist's dream MMO. But, in a sense, the idea underlying Libertarianism is that forces array themselves to remove our liberty in exchange for order and security. Both the Illuminati and Templar factions have that goal - to control the world. The Templars do it to promote order and "righteousness," while the Illuminati do it for power and profit. The third faction, the Dragon, promote chaos and anarchy so that they can control the world through the natural flow of fate (which they can predict).
